    I have a custom built pc that is running windows 2000. Recently when I try to boot up my pc everything goes fine until it gets to the part where you would normally log onto windows then the screen gets totally distorted and just freezes. I can't make out anything thats on the screen. I tried booting up in safe mode and my pc still froze except I didn't get the distorted screen. Again everything shows up fine on the screen until it gets to the part where I would log on. I can see the "windows is starting" screen and everything before that but after that screen everything gets blurry and I can't do anything. Any ideas what could be causing this or what I can do to fix it. I don't have recovery cds or anything. I lost them a long time ago. What do I do? Thanks very much in advance!!!!!

    Well where to start

    First you need to go into your bios settings to change your boot sequence and just move your CD/DVD Boot Sequence to check that first in the bios setting.

    Once you have setup your boot sequence to be the CD drive then just put the disc in and then the computer will recognize that the disc is in and it will tell you to press any key to boot from CD... just do that and go through the XP Installation.

    And that should do it.
